-2

フォーム認証とSSOを統合する必要のあるWebベースのアプリケーションを作成しました。現在、フォーム認証は登録されているすべてのユーザーを検証します。 私が必要とするのは、SSOもアプリケーションに統合することです。つまり、ユーザーが認証されていない場合は、WS-Fedで構成されたIDサーバー(Okta)にリダイレクトし、アプリケーションを追加し、ランディングページへの応答と応答を行います。これで助けてください。必要な情報があれば教えてください。フォーム認証とSSO

+0

このタイプのサービスを企業に提供することに専念している全社があります。 1)私は1のために働かない。 2)私がした場合、*私はあなたにそれを請求します*。 –

答えて

0

「このユーザーは認証されていない場合、WS-Fedで構成されたIDサーバー(Okta)にリダイレクトしてアプリケーションを追加しましたか?

このリンクhttps://github.com/okta/okta-music-storeを参照してください。 「シングルサインオンをミュージックストアに追加する」セクションでは、C#sdkを使用してシングルサインオンを実装する方法を確認できます。

あなたが必要とするものは、OktaのcookieTokenです。 CookieTokenをワンタイムトークンとリダイレクトURL(あなたのアプリのURLにすることができます)として使用するには、/ login/sessionCookieRedirect?token = & redirectUrl =を使用できます。これにより、Oktaとのアクティブなセッションが作成され、ユーザーをアプリにリダイレクトするか、またはuriをリダイレクトします。

クッキートークンは、2回の呼び出しによって取得されます。セッショントークンを応答する認証。セッショントークンは、セッションコールの作成を介して、クッキートークンと交換される。